Cycling

The cycle routes near your new home are presented below including local cycle route and National Cycle Routes (NCR).  The local cycle route near your home is the Barnham to Walberton cycle path which is a 2km trail.  This provides a connection near to the NCR route 2 near Bognor Regis. Route 2 also can be joined in Chichester. While route 88 runs from Chichester to West Dean.

Bus Services

Your closest bus stop is located c. 280m from your new home at Level Mare Lane on Fontwell Avenue. Other services are provided from Ivy Lane which is located c.1km on Westergate Street. Regular bus services provide links to Chichester, Arundel and Westergate

Rail services

Barnham Railway Station is located approximately 2.7 km from your home; accessible within a 34-minute walk or a 9-minute cycle. Providing regular services to Portsmouth & Southsea, Southampton Central, London Victoria, Brighton, and Bognor Regis.

Station Facilities

  • 62 cycle storage spaces with CCTV
  • 130 car parking spaces and 2 accessible
  • Step free access
  • Toilets
  • ATM machine
  • Waiting room
  • WiFi

Car Sharing

Liftshare – West Sussex car share is part of the liftshare network. It is a great way to get around your local area for day trips or work events at a fraction of the price. A commuter can typically save around £1,000 a year by carsharing. Reduce stress and cut your carbon footprint at the same time.
